Last Updated: Sep 27, 2025 (UTC)Intrasoft: Profits Up, Stock Down - A Mixed September
Detailed Analysis
- On September 26, 2025, an analyst issued a "Strong Sell" recommendation for Intrasoft Technologies, setting a long-term stop-loss target of ₹116.85 and a short-term stop-loss of ₹101.92, while the stock closed at ₹99.07 – signaling a bearish outlook for investors. This recommendation adds to the concerns surrounding the stock despite recent positive financial results.
- Despite a generally negative outlook, Intrasoft Technologies showed short-term strength as of September 24, 2025, with the stock price reaching ₹103.34, a 4.65% increase over the past week, outperforming the Sensex's 1.18% gain. However, this positive movement is contrasted by a year-to-date decline of -32.17% and a one-year return of -34.18%, highlighting the stock's volatility.
- An AI Munafa prediction on September 25, 2025, indicated sideways movement for Intrasoft Technologies, assigning a value of 45, suggesting a lack of clear directional momentum. While the price remained above a significant level of ₹102.19, the prediction also pointed to a weakening of a previous uptrend.
- Daily stock price fluctuations continued throughout the month, with the stock trading at ₹102.69 (down 1.94%) and ₹99.07 (down 3.28%) on September 24, 2025, and ₹101.06 (up 1.34%) on September 23, 2025, demonstrating ongoing volatility. These fluctuations reflect the market's uncertainty regarding the company's future performance.
- Earlier in the month, on September 9, 2025, Intrasoft Technologies reported FY2024-2025 revenue of ₹507.2 Cr, a 4% year-over-year increase, and a 29% jump in Profit After Tax (PAT) to ₹12.7 Cr. Despite these positive results, the share price had decreased by 3.63% over the past six months and 43.16% over the last year, closing at ₹97.73.
- On September 22, 2025, the company reported a Quarterly Net Profit of ₹0 Cr, a substantial year-over-year growth of 2654.3%, but the share price decreased by 3.63% that day, closing at ₹105.88, with high trading volume of 97,011, indicating the market wasn't fully reacting positively to the profit growth.
- As of September 11, 2025, Intrasoft Technologies had a market capitalization of ₹161.49 Cr, with a PE ratio of 12.65 and a PB ratio of 0.72. Total assets decreased by 28.02% year-over-year to 282.52, while total liabilities decreased by 70.17% year-over-year to 54.02, indicating a restructuring of the company's balance sheet.
